On the occasion of Pranav Mohanlal's birthday, 13 July 2025, the makers of his upcoming Malayalam horror film Dies Irae unveiled a striking new poster, instantly setting social media abuzz. Featuring Pranav in a rugged, intense avatar, the red-tinted poster has prompted fans and netizens to put on their detective hats, offering wild and intriguing theories ranging from 'cult member' speculation to 'Illuminati' references.
Dies Irae, helmed by acclaimed horror filmmaker Rahul Sadasivan known for Bhoothakaalam and Bramayugam stars Pranav in the lead. The new poster, which dropped at midnight, shows three mysterious pairs of legs in the background, leading several fans to suggest that Pranav's character may be involved in sinister rituals.
'Is he some sort of cult member sacrificing women he seduces??? You can see two other women on the floor. Damn interesting, Rahul Sadasivan so no doubts on the quality,' read one Reddit comment that has since gained traction.

Moondru Mudichu: Everything about the family drama starring Swathi Konde, Niyas Khan, and Preethi Sanjiv

The popular Tamil television serial Moondru Mudichu has captured the hearts of viewers and recently reached an impressive milestone of 271 episodes. Starring Swathi Konde , Niyas Khan, and Preethi Sanjiv in lead roles, this emotional family drama continues to be a staple in many households, thanks to its gripping storyline and relatable characters. Premiering in August 2024, Moondru Mudichu is the Tamil adaptation of the Telugu series Moodu Mullu and Malayalam's Sitara. The show quickly gained traction for its emotionally layered plot and strong performances. Meet the cast Alongside the leads, Swathi Konde as Nandini, Niyas Khan as Suryakumar, and Preethi Sanjiv, the show boasts a powerful ensemble cast that includes Prabhakaran Chandran, Krithika Laddu, Dharshna Sripal Golecha, Sai Lavanyaa, Agathiyan, Poraali Dileepan, Meena Vemuri, Theni Murukan, Geetha Ravishankar, Durai Sudhakar , Winner Ramachandran, Sundari Sekhar, Singapore Deepan, Kavya Bellu , T Jayanthi, Pulikutty Selvam, M. Sukanya, R. Ashok Pandiyan, and Manikandan Raj. Their performances add significant depth and dimension to the series. Storyline The narrative centres around Nandini, a kind-hearted young woman raised by her single father in a village. With her family's well-being always as her top priority, Nandini becomes entangled with Suryakumar, a wealthy businessman estranged from his mother. His complex family dynamics and resentment toward his mother lead him to manipulate Nandini into a marriage, hoping to create turmoil. Despite a rocky start, the relationship between Nandini and Suryakumar evolves, turning into a tale of unexpected love and emotional growth. As the story progresses, Moondru Mudichu explores Nandini's struggles and strength as she navigates the complexities of life in Suryakumar's joint family, delivering compelling drama and emotional resonance. Where to watch Moondru Mudichu airs on Sun TV at 8:30 PM and continues to hold a loyal viewership, thanks to its gripping screenplay and heartfelt performances.

Karuppu Teaser: Suriya delights fans with massy action on his 50th birthday under RJ Balaji's direction- watch

Karuppu Teaser: On the 50th birthday of South film industry superstar Suriya, the makers have released the explosive teaser of his much-awaited film 'Karuppu'. Suriya is seen doing fierce fighting in the teaser of the upcoming film. The action thriller film, produced under the banner of Dream Warrior Pictures, is directed by RJ Balaji. The production house shared the teaser on the social media platform X account and wrote in the caption that on this special day of Suriya sir, we are very excited to present the spectacular teaser of Karuppu. What is Suriya's character in Karuppu? At the beginning of the teaser. It is shown in the teaser that the Karuppu deity is being worshipped with chillies. Also, a voice is heard saying, This is not a peaceful deity who should be worshipped peacefully. If you offer chilies with true devotion, then this is a fierce deity who gives immediate justice. Watch Karuppu Teaser: Suriya treats fans with a new look in the Karuppu teaser After this, the audience is introduced to Suriya's character 'Saravanan', also known as 'Karuppu'. He plays the role of a lawyer in the film. There are many action scenes in the teaser, which present it as an entertaining film. Suriya is seen speaking many powerful dialogues, such as, Blast! Brother, this is our time; we have to teach everyone a lesson. Suriya to romance this actress in Karuppu? Actress Trisha Krishnan is in the lead role with Suriya in the film. Trisha has previously worked with Suriya in the 2005 film 'Aaru'. Apart from Suriya and Trisha, the film also stars Malayalam actors Indras, Sivada, Swasika, and Tamil actors Yogi Babu, Natarajan Subramaniam in important roles. The music of the film has been composed by young musician Sai Abhyankar. Cinematography is done by GK Vishnu, editing is done by R. Kalaivanan, and stunt choreography is done by Vikram More, while art direction is by Arun Venjaramoodu. The film is expected to release on Deepavali.

Ronth: Roshan Mathew on why Shahi Kabir's cop drama is one of the ‘most memorable journeys'

Roshan Mathew, who kickstarted his acting career in Malayalam cinema, has made a mark in Bollywood too with movies such as Alia Bhatt-starrer Darlings. The young actor recently appeared as a cop in the Malayalam film Ronth, which has now dropped on JioHotstar and OTTplay Premium. In an exclusive interview with OTTplay, Roshan Mathew speaks about playing the rookie cop Dinnathan in the film, which is helmed by filmmaker-writer Shahi Kabir and also stars Dileesh Pothan, who is a filmmaker himself. Roshan Mathew stars as a cop in Ronth Roshan Mathew on Ronth Roshan Mathew starred in one of the lead roles in the 2025 Malayalam film Ronth, which opened to positive reviews. In a recent chat with OTTplay, Roshan Mathew recounted that it was a great experience to be a part of Shahi Kabir's film. 'Ronth is a film that I have had one of the most memorable and one of the longest journeys. Because I have been part of the film right from pretty much when we started off on the project and I have a feeling I will be with it right till the end, the journey is still continuing,' he remarked. In the slow-burn cop drama, Roshan appears as the more vulnerable of the two cops, as they go about their patrolling duties. The film's director Shahi Kabir, who has also penned other cop movies such as Joseph and the recent Officer on Duty, is a former cop himself. 'It was a great character to play. The kind of insight that Shahi comes with on policing and the human side of policemen and his potential as a filmmaker, I believe in and enjoy working with,' he remarked. His co-actor is Dileesh Pothan, who plays the senior and tough officer Yohannan. Speaking about his experience of acting alongside him, Roshan says, 'He has really inspired me with the work he has done. I also think he is a fabulous actor. We worked together in a movie called Moothon in 2018. And this is the second time we are working together. I am just grateful for the experience I have had working as a co-actor.' Dileesh Pothan is also a noted filmmaker, having helmed films such as Thondimuthalum Driksakshiyum. The film stars Fahadh Faasil in the lead, and is available for streaming on JioHotstar via OTTplay Premium.
